The Mechanics of Mayhem: Understanding the Gameplay

At its core, the gameplay of a crazy tower arcade game revolves around strategically placing blocks to build the tallest possible tower. However, the core premise is made significantly more challenging by the dynamic, often erratic movement of the blocks themselves. These blocks don't simply drop neatly into place; they wobble, rotate, and shift unpredictably, demanding precise timing and quick adjustments from the player. The initial blocks may appear straightforward, but as the tower grows, the difficulty escalates rapidly. The blocks often become smaller, lighter, or shaped in more unconventional ways, further complicating the stacking process. Mastering the game requires a symbiotic relationship between observation, anticipation, and execution.

The Importance of Precision and Timing

Successfully building a high-scoring tower is less about brute force and more about mastering the delicate art of precision and timing. Players must carefully observe the block's trajectory, accounting for its inherent instability and any external forces affecting its movement. Pressing the action button at the precise moment when the block is aligned with the tower’s center is crucial. Even a fraction of a second off can result in a disastrous collapse, sending the tower tumbling down and resetting the player's progress. Experienced players often develop a sense of rhythm, anticipating the block’s movements and executing their actions with fluid, instinctive timing. This skill requires practice and a deep understanding of the game’s physics engine.

Strategies for Tower Domination

While luck certainly plays a role, there are several strategies players can employ to significantly improve their performance in a crazy tower arcade game. One fundamental technique is to focus on building a wide, stable base. A solid foundation is essential for supporting the weight of the increasingly unstable blocks that will be added later on. Attempting to stack blocks directly on top of each other early in the game is a recipe for disaster. Instead, prioritize creating a broad, well-distributed base that can absorb some of the forces generated by the wobbling blocks. Another important tactic is to anticipate the block's movements and compensate accordingly.

Leveraging Game-Specific Mechanics

Many crazy tower arcade games incorporate unique mechanics that can be exploited by savvy players. Some games might offer a “slow-motion” feature, allowing for more precise block placement. Others might introduce different types of blocks with varying weights, shapes, or properties. Learning to effectively utilize these game-specific mechanics is crucial for maximizing your score. For example, if a game features a heavier block, strategically placing it near the base of the tower can provide added stability. Experimenting with different approaches and observing how the game responds is the key to unlocking its hidden potential. Understanding the nuances of each mechanic will elevate your gameplay from novice to expert.

The Evolution of the Tower Game: From Arcades to Digital Realms

The crazy tower arcade game’s initial success in arcades paved the way for numerous adaptations and iterations. The core mechanics of stacking blocks under challenging conditions proved remarkably adaptable to a variety of platforms. As technology advanced, we saw the emergence of digital versions of the game on home consoles, personal computers, and eventually, mobile devices. These digital adaptations often introduced new features and enhancements, such as improved graphics, more complex physics engines, and multiplayer modes. However, the fundamental gameplay loop remained largely intact, preserving the addictive quality that made the original arcade version so popular.

The Impact of Mobile Gaming

The rise of mobile gaming has been particularly significant for the crazy tower genre. The simplicity of the gameplay lends itself perfectly to the touch-screen interface of smartphones and tablets. Mobile versions often feature streamlined controls, bite-sized levels, and social features that allow players to compete with friends and share their high scores. This accessibility has brought the game to a wider audience than ever before. The mobile platform also facilitates frequent updates and additions, allowing developers to continuously refine the gameplay and introduce new challenges. Moreover, many mobile tower games adopt a free-to-play model, enticing players with in-app purchases and ads.
